This is the start of a wonderful thing...my Lady Gaga costume for Halloween 2009.
It is modeled after the outfit she wore at the end of the Paparazzi music video.

The songs are "Eh, Eh (Nothing Else I Can Say)" and "Paparazzi" by Lady Gaga (of course).

  • can you please show us what you need for this and not go to fast ? PLEASE

  • @lezziakinom

    I used black gorilla tape (duct tape, but stronger), a cereal box and two half spheres of styrofoam from a craft shop. Beyond that, I was just kind of making it up as I went. I had never made any other tape crafts before this, so it was just trial and error, which is what made it so fun.
